Tie — Baby Name Meaning and Origin
Tie
Meaning of Tie:
Tie is a short and sweet masculine name with various origins. It can be derived from English, where it represents the strong bond of connections and relationships. It can also have Chinese origins, where it means 'steel' or 'iron'. The name Tie carries the meaning of strength, durability, and resilience. It is a simple yet impactful name, representing the solid foundation and unbreakable spirit of a boy.
